I can't draw very well. but, essentially the shape of DNA is a double helix and A pairs with T and T pairs with A. C pairs with G and G pairs with C. No matter what in DNA. What one side has the other side has. The other will always have the match to it on the other side
A= adenine
T=thymine
C=Cytosine
G=guanine
